The Archbishop of Owerri Ecclesiastical Province, His Grace, Dr. Anthony J V Obinna, has accused the Imo State Governor, Rochas Okorocha, of running for third term in office through his son-in-law.

The cleric said there was no peace in Imo State because of high level injustice and inequity by the state government.


Obinna, who said this while fielding questions from reporters yesterday at Maria Assumpta Cathedral, Owerri, reasoned that “there cannot be true peace in the face of glaring injustice and inequity in Imo State and Nigeria.

“Things are so bad in Imo State that even when any group has police permit to stage a peaceful rally or protest, the government of the day will use coercion and brute force to deny them this fundamental right.”

Answering a question on the Imo Charter of Equity, the cleric said, “Equity is a concept for justice.

“Although it was not my brainchild, since it was fashioned out to engineer peace and justice in the state, I support it.


“Equity demands that the senatorial zones should take their turns on the governorship seat.”

According to the Archbishop, he has “no special hatred for Governor Rochas Okorocha”, adding that “it was most uncharitable for the governor to attempt doing a third term through his son in-law, Uche Nwosu.”

One of the reasons I like Okorocha. He is more advanced in thinking than the opposition sponsoring media attacks against him. He thinks well and acts well ahead of time. He has decongested Owerri greatly by moving of Ekeukwu to Alaba market in Naze and New market at Egbeada Mbaitoli as well as mechanics and auto markets to Avu. Not only that, he has also moved Keke business to those area thereby building new and busy suburbs outside the city for a lot of people to move in. To make movement from city center to those areas easy, he is expanding all the major roads in city center and created dozens of alternative routes and bridges across the river linking 2 sides of Owerri. He is also rebuilding all the small village markets to encoirage rural trading in more convenient environment with solar powered all night lighting.

The Major problem with Rochas and his development, is lack of planning.

No detailed plan before embarking on any work.

Rochas travels and sights a piece of structure, once he gets back to Owerri, he assembles his local contractor and demands the monument, feature be replicated in the state.

Now, consider the giant lamppost he is erecting aside the roads. They are so big , their bases take up most of the walk way ( pedestrian walkway)
such that people are having to now walk on the road to evade the post . Essentially , when the sideways are to be properly constructed , the pillar and maybe the post will have to go - another waste of scarce fund by Rochas.

Schools: Rochas undoubted reconstructed a few decent schools in mostly owerri, and build over 100- 300 primary school in electrol ward ( at various stages of abandonment) . Imagine if this was properly planned ?
27 Standard school could have been built. one in each local governement, with exisiting schools, given a decent facelift, paint and ceiling and roofing .

Hospital: Imagine embarking on building 27 General hospitals ? That would have produce one standard western standard hospital. Rebuilt the Univeristy teaching hospital. And the a Nursing college.

Roads: why build 6 lane roads, when many major road within the state , even owerri is still in shambles. makes absolutely no sense.

Ugly monuments- see the Aka chi, a waste of resources. abandoned, becos if was not planned. no after thought of what it would be , how to commercialize it etc.


The only point i will not take away from Rochas, would be the expansion of the state capital, which is simply done by building roads ( very very substandard roads to connect areas of the state . same could have been replicated in the other towns in the state orlu and okigwe to help spurn developement in those areas too.
